Why is my dryer not heating?

Most common causes are a blown thermal fuse, failed heating element, bad thermostat, or a clogged vent.

Should I have my dryer vent cleaned?

Yes — clogged vents are one of the leading causes of house fires. We include a vent inspection on every dryer call.
